Are people in Boston older or younger than people in Berwick?
- The Median Age in Boston is 7.5 years younger than in Berwick.

Are housing costs cheaper in Boston or Berwick?
- Boston housing costs are 64.0% more expensive than Berwick hous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Boston or Berwick?
- The average commute for residents of Boston is 1.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Berwick.

Things to do in Berwick?
Berwick, Maine is a small town located in the southern part of the state that has a population of about 4,000 people. It's a great place to live and raise a family due to its rural setting and friendly atmosphere. There are plenty of parks and outdoor activities available, as well as small local businesses that offer unique shopping experiences. The schools are top-notch, and there are many cultural offerings in the area, such as theater performances and art galleries. Berwick is known for its annual corn festival held every summer which brings locals and visitors together to celebrate the harvest season. It's an ideal spot for anyone looking to enjoy the peacefulness of small-town living while still being close enough to larger cities like Portsmouth or Portland for convenience.

Things to do in Boston?
Boston, Massachusetts is a bustling metropolitan city with plenty to offer. From the renowned Freedom Trail and Fenway Park to the scenic Charles River and Beacon Hill, visitors of all ages will find something to do in this historic city. Tour Harvard University or take a walk through the cobblestone streets of Beacon Hill and see why it's known as one of America's most charming cities. From art and history museums to sports venues and delicious seafood restaurants, Boston has it all for anyone looking for an unforgettable experience.
